Troy Adds Florida A&M to 2024 Football Schedule
5/8/2020 10:00:00 AM | Football
Â
TROY, Ala. – Troy added another piece to its future football schedule with the addition of Florida A&M to open the 2024 season (Aug. 31) at The Vet, both schools announced Friday. It is Troy's third non-conference game on the books for the 2024 campaign.
Â
This will be the seventh all-time meeting between Troy and Florida A&M with the Trojans holding a 4-2 advantage in the series. Troy has won both meetings since it moved to the FBS ranks, including a 59-7 win in 2018.
Â
The schools met three times over a four-year period in the late 90s with all three meetings occurring in the FCS Playoffs, while the first meeting came during the 1984 season at the Gator Bowl in Jacksonville, Fla.
Â
Florida A&M joins Southern Miss to fill out Troy's home non-conference slate in 2024. The Trojans are scheduled to travel to Memphis that year in addition to another yet to be scheduled opponent.

The Trojans enter year two under head coach Chip Lindsey with the second most wins by an FBS program in the state of Alabama over the last four seasons and the sixth most among schools in the Group of Five conferences.
Troy returns a pair of All-Americans on defense in junior linebacker Carlton Martial and sophomore safety Dell Pettus, while the offense returns a slew of playmakers from a unit that was one of the best in the country a season ago. The Trojans featured a top-25 scoring offense (33.8 points per game) and top-18 overall offense (456.3 yards per game).Â
